数据库连接空值填什么

不及物动词 其他 19

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在数据库连接中,如果需要填写空值,可以使用NULL来表示。NULL是一种特殊的值,表示没有具体的数值或数据。在数据库中,NULL可以用于表示缺少值或未知值。

    以下是关于在数据库连接中空值填写的一些要点:

    1. 在SQL语句中使用NULL:
      在SQL语句中,可以使用NULL来表示空值。例如,如果要在一个表的某个字段中插入空值,可以使用INSERT语句,并将字段的值设置为NULL。示例:

      INSERT INTO table_name (column_name) VALUES (NULL);
      
    2. 在程序中使用NULL:
      在程序中连接数据库时,可以使用相应的编程语言来处理空值。不同的编程语言有不同的表示空值的方式。例如,在Java中,可以使用null关键字来表示空值。示例:

      String value = null;
      
    3. 处理空值的注意事项:
      在数据库连接中处理空值时,需要注意以下几点:

      • 空值与空字符串不同:空值表示缺少值或未知值,而空字符串表示字符串长度为0。
      • 空值与零不同:空值表示缺少值,而零表示具体的数值。
      • 空值的比较:在SQL语句中,不能使用等于号(=)来比较空值,而应该使用IS NULL或IS NOT NULL来判断字段是否为空值。
    4. 使用COALESCE函数处理空值:
      COALESCE函数是一种常用的处理空值的方法。它可以接受多个参数,并返回第一个非空值。如果所有参数都是空值,则返回NULL。示例:

      SELECT COALESCE(column_name, 'N/A') FROM table_name;
      
    5. 避免空值引发的问题:
      在数据库设计和数据录入时,应该尽量避免空值的出现。空值可能导致数据不一致或产生错误的计算结果。可以通过设置字段的默认值、使用约束条件、进行数据验证等方式来避免空值的问题。

    总结起来,数据库连接中空值可以使用NULL来表示。在SQL语句中使用INSERT或UPDATE语句插入空值,程序中使用相应的编程语言处理空值。处理空值时需要注意空值与空字符串、空值与零的区别,以及使用COALESCE函数等方法来处理空值。同时,应该尽量避免空值的出现,以确保数据的一致性和准确性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库连接中,如果需要填充空值,可以根据具体情况选择不同的方法。

    一种常见的方法是使用空字符串("")来填充空值。空字符串表示一个没有任何字符的字符串,可以作为一个占位符,表示该字段没有具体的值。这种方法适用于字符串类型的字段,例如varchar、text等。

    另一种常见的方法是使用特定的数值来填充空值。例如,可以使用0来表示一个数值类型的字段为空。这种方法适用于数值类型的字段,例如int、float等。

    此外,还可以使用特定的标志值来填充空值。例如,可以使用NULL来表示一个空值。NULL是数据库中表示缺失或未知值的特殊值,可以用于各种数据类型的字段。

    除了以上方法外,还可以根据具体的业务需求选择其他填充方式。例如,可以使用默认值来填充空值,或者使用特定的占位符来表示空值。

    需要注意的是,对于数据库连接中的空值填充,应该根据具体情况选择合适的方法,并且在编写代码时要做好相应的处理。同时,应该遵循数据库设计的规范,确保数据的完整性和一致性。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库连接空值填什么是一个常见的问题。在数据库连接过程中,如果某个参数需要填写空值,通常可以填写NULL、空字符串("")或者特定的标识符,具体取决于数据库管理系统和编程语言的要求。

    下面我将从不同数据库管理系统和编程语言的角度,分别讲解数据库连接空值填写的方法和操作流程。

    1. MySQL数据库连接空值填写方法:
      在MySQL中,连接数据库时,可以使用以下方法填写空值:
    • 使用NULL关键字:可以将连接参数设置为NULL,例如:host=NULL、user=NULL、password=NULL。
    • 使用空字符串(""):可以将连接参数设置为空字符串,例如:host=""、user=""、password=""。
    • 使用特定的标识符:有些情况下,特定的标识符被用来表示空值,例如:host="localhost"、user="root"、password=" "。
    1. Oracle数据库连接空值填写方法:
      在Oracle中,连接数据库时,可以使用以下方法填写空值:
    • 使用NULL关键字:可以将连接参数设置为NULL,例如:host=NULL、user=NULL、password=NULL。
    • 使用空字符串(""):可以将连接参数设置为空字符串,例如:host=""、user=""、password=""。
    • 使用特定的标识符:有些情况下,特定的标识符被用来表示空值,例如:host="localhost"、user="sys"、password=" "。
    1. SQL Server数据库连接空值填写方法:
      在SQL Server中,连接数据库时,可以使用以下方法填写空值:
    • 使用NULL关键字:可以将连接参数设置为NULL,例如:Data Source=NULL、User ID=NULL、Password=NULL。
    • 使用空字符串(""):可以将连接参数设置为空字符串,例如:Data Source=""、User ID=""、Password=""。
    • 使用特定的标识符:有些情况下,特定的标识符被用来表示空值,例如:Data Source="localhost"、User ID="sa"、Password=" "。
    1. Java语言中数据库连接空值填写方法:
      在Java语言中,使用JDBC连接数据库时,可以使用以下方法填写空值:
    • 使用null关键字:可以将连接参数设置为null,例如:String url = null、String user = null、String password = null。
    • 使用空字符串(""):可以将连接参数设置为空字符串,例如:String url = ""、String user = ""、String password = ""。

    总结:
    在不同的数据库管理系统和编程语言中,填写数据库连接空值的方法可能有所不同。通常可以使用NULL关键字、空字符串("")或特定的标识符来表示空值。在实际应用中,根据具体的系统要求和编程语言的规范,选择合适的方法来填写数据库连接空值。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部